                Originally posted by colesks
                I had a similar experience in that after 3 months, the dye still did not show a blockage of the tube on one side. I had to go back 3 months later and have the test done again. At that time, the blockage was confirmed on both sides.

                To back up, I scheduled the Essure procedure for March of 2007. I was told I needed to have a shot of Depo Provera at the onset of my period the month before to help thin the lining of my uterus. I got the depo shot in February. I spotted daily from it, along with the monthly period. When in June my test did not show a blockage, my doctor had me get another depo shot. I wasn't wild about the idea, but I did it anyhow. This was in June. Spotted daily until November of 2007. Then, started getting my period about every 14-20 days and it's super heavy. This has been ongoing.

                I mentioned this at my annual exam and doc ordered blood tests (came back normal) and an ultrasound which the tech (a) saw the essure coils in my tubes and (b) saw numerous tiny cysts on my ovaries. He took an endometrial biopsy and the results were due today. This was 5 days ago. Yesterday, my body expelled one of the supposedly scarred in Essure coils, after 18 months!!!

                I left him a message this am about the coil, and the nurse called a while ago with my biopsy results (normal). So I asked the nurse **again** for the doc to call me, as I haven't found a thing on google about women expelling the coils after so long. I'm hoping I'm not pregnant (I don't know if they were in the right place when the ultrasound tech saw them) and I got no idea from the nurse what a normal biopsy means, since I don't know what he was hoping to find/not find on the biopsy anyhow. It would be nice if he would call me back to tell me what the heck is going on.

                I never had cysts before all of this, and my cycle was 28 days like clockwork. I can't help but think that my problems all go back to Essure. I still have the one coil in there somewhere, but I'm thinking tubal ligation the old fashioned way along with a side of novasure to take care of the period issue.

                Argh! It's frustrating to me because I'm a little freaked out by this coil showing up on my toilet paper. Even the nurse this morning was like, "it came OUT?! Are you sure that's what it is???" You'd think after 2 messages my doctor would be calling me to find out what the heck is going on.

                Anyone else have an experience like this with Essure?
